info_outlineCommunity Health as Community Development | Rev. Dr. James Brooks
Recorded live at the 2025 CCHF Conference, this workshop with Rev. Dr. James Brooks explores how healthcare and community development intersect in Lawndale. Through the story of Lawndale Christian Health Center, discover how addressing food deserts, strengthening local partnerships, and engaging churches and schools are reshaping what it means to pursue whole-community health.
Dr. Brooks shares both the challenges and the triumphs of this journey, offering inspiring stories of resilience, collaboration, and faith at work in the heart of Chicago. Tune in to hear how Lawndale is redefining healthcare—not just as clinical care, but as a movement toward a healthier, more connected community.

CCHFTalk is a production of Christian Community Health Fellowship.
CCHF's Mission: The mission of Christian Community Health Fellowship is to encourage, engage and equip Christians to live out the gospel through healthcare among the poor and marginalized.
CCHF's Vision: We envision a movement of God's people who choose daily to promote healing in marginalized communities in the name of Jesus.
